Some Charges Dropped Against Man in New Hampshire Teen's Abduction, Rape

A New Hampshire prosecutor has dropped threatening and other charges against the man accused of kidnapping and raping a teenage girl over the course of nine months.

Nathaniel Kibby of Gorham still faces more than 200 charges when he's tried in June in the kidnapping of a 14-year-old girl in October 2013.

But Cheshire County Attorney Chris McLaughlin on Thursday opted to drop charges that the 35-year-old Kibby made threats against the lead prosecutor in the case, Senior Assistant Attorney General Jane Young.

McLaughlin did not immediately return a call seeking comment on why he dropped the charges.

Young declined to comment.

Kibby's lawyer, Jesse Friedman, called the outcome "correct and just," saying the charges - filed last summer - lacked merit from the outset.
